Ingredients
  

2 lbs beef chuck roast, cut into 1-inch cubes

1 medium onion, diced

3 cloves garlic, minced

8 oz mushrooms, sliced (button or cremini)

1 cup beef broth

1 cup sour cream

2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ce

1 tbsp Dijon mustard

1 tsp paprika

Salt and pepper to taste

3 tbsp olive oil

1 tbsp cornstarch (optional, for thickening)

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

12 oz egg noodles or your pasta of choice

Instructions
 

Sauté the Beef: In a large skillet over medium-high heat, heat the olive oil. Season the beef cubes with salt and pepper. Sear the beef in batches, browning on all sides (about 5-7 minutes). Transfer the browned beef to the slow cooker.

    Sauté Onions and Mushrooms: In the same skillet, add the diced onion and mushrooms. Sauté until softened (about 5 minutes). Add the minced garlic and sauté for an additional minute until fragrant. Transfer this mixture to the slow cooker.

      Add Liquid Ingredients: In a bowl, combine the beef broth, Worcestershire sauce, Dijon mustard, and paprika. Pour this mixture over the beef and vegetables in the slow cooker. Stir gently to combine.

        Slow Cook: Cover and cook on low for 7-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the beef is tender and easily shreds.

          Make it Creamy: About 30 minutes before serving, stir in the sour cream. If you prefer a thicker sauce, mix the cornstarch with 2 tbsp of water and add it to the slow cooker, stirring until well blended. Allow the sauce to thicken while cooking for the final half-hour.

            Cook the Noodles: Prepare the egg noodles according to package instructions in a separate pot. Drain and set aside.

              Serve: Once the stroganoff is done, taste and adjust seasoning as necessary. Serve the creamy beef stroganoff over the cooked egg noodles. Garnish with fresh chopped parsley.

                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 20 minutes | 8 hours | 6 servings
